The ADCC 2026 Announcement: A Game-Changer for Jiu-Jitsu
Yes, you read it right: ADCC is officially coming to Poland in 2026! This announcement has ignited excitement across the MMA community and beyond. Imagine the buzz at your favorite gym as fighters and fans alike discuss this unprecedented move. ADCC, renowned for its elite submission grappling competitions, is taking its show on the road, and Poland is set to be the next big stage.
Quick Fact: ADCC stands for Abu Dhabi Combat Club, the organization behind one of the most respected grappling tournaments in the world. With top-tier athletes and passionate fans, this event promises to put Polish jiu-jitsu on the international map.
FAQs and Key Details You Need to Know
We get it—you’re curious and have a ton of questions. Here’s a handy breakdown:
- What is ADCC? It’s one of the premier grappling competitions, drawing the best fighters from around the globe.
- Why Poland? The choice highlights the growing popularity and development of Brazilian jiu-jitsu in Eastern Europe.
- What does this mean for local talent? Expect increased investment in training facilities, more international exposure, and a significant boost in participation from young athletes.
